HOUSTON FARMS DEVELOPMENT CO. v. UNITED STATES

No. 10304.

132 F.2d 861 (1943)

HOUSTON FARMS DEVELOPMENT CO. v. UNITED STATES.

Circuit Court of Appeals, Fifth Circuit.

January 27, 1943.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

L. E. Blankenbecker, of Houston, Tex., for appellant.

Earl C. Crouter and Sewall Key, Sp. Assts. to Atty. Gen., Samuel O. Clark, Jr., Asst. Atty. Gen., and Brian S. Odem, Asst. U. S. Atty., of Houston, Tex., for appellee.

Before SIBLEY, HUTCHESON, and HOLMES, Circuit Judges.


PER CURIAM.

It is ordered that the petition for a rehearing in the above numbered and entitled cause be, and it is hereby, denied.
